Question: If someone has flattening diaphragm, high rdw, low mcv and blood is coming out while he's coughing, what all diseases could it point to. The person is diabetic and has history bronchitis. Kindly answer as soon as possible. Thank you.
doctor
Answered by Dr. Drkaushal85 (38 minutes later)
Brief Answer:
This is worsening of bronchitis.

Detailed Answer:
Thanks for your question on Ask a doctor forum.
I can understand your concern.
By your history and description, possibility of worsening of bronchitis is more likely.
But we need to rule out lung infection also.
So better to consult pulmonologist and get done clinical examination of respiratory system and chest x ray.
Chest x ray is must for the diagnosis of lung infection.
